Output 095fecaef1c8382659cf744a0da8d787ec5a34149b5a8c2029156e59405705a5:4

value
43993456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b35edb84dd122d9492f91741ad9d1f39e38cd43 OP_EQUAL
address
MN3qaBsbJryt1oDfUHsMygQYG8hbJDvxnk
transaction
095fecaef1c8382659cf744a0da8d787ec5a34149b5a8c2029156e59405705a5
spent
true